Book Review: Crabgrass: Comic Adventures by Tauhid Bondia
★★★★☆
I love Crabgrass so much! I follow the comic as it's posted online, and I have grown incredibly fond of Miles' and Kevin's adventures. Normally, I'm not a major comic person, but there is something so refreshing about the innocent childhood goofiness this comic offers. Both boys seem like they should be so different: Miles as the straight A good kid only child and Kevin as the troublemaker one of four from a financially struggling family. However, they click so wonderfully, and I really appreciate how Tauhid Bondia both allows them to have plenty of shenanigans while also tackling important issues in between (that camping arc ending!!). While there are some longer arcs, I appreciate the collection of the one-off moments that both follow the previous set-ups and also build the world out. It's just so enjoyable! If you need a light-hearted brain break with some endearing characters, definitely check out Crabgrass!
